Jyothishmathi Sheejith

biography

Jyothishmathi Sheejith is an accomplished Carnatic vocalist and composer who received her four-year undergraduate and two-year postgraduate diploma in music from the Kalakshetra Foundation in 1997. Having studied Carnatic vocal from such doyens as Vairamangalam Lakshminarayanan and S Rajaram, she has sung in the lead for many classic Kalakshetra Repertory ensemble dance productions. As an independent artist, she has toured worldwide with illustrious Bharatanatyam dancers such as CV Chandrasekhar, VP and Shanta Dhananjayan, Leela Samson, and Malavika Sarukkai. A graded artist of All India Radio, she has conducted workshops and served as faculty in teaching residencies in India and abroad. Jyothishmathi has composed several musical scores for dance as an individual artist and in partnership with dancer-choreographer husband Sheejith Krishna. Their innovative and critically lauded collaborations include Masquerade (2007), Krishna Bharatam (2009), Parinaamam (2010), Pravaha (2013), Yathadarshe Tathaatmani (2014) and Don Quixote (2015).
